Output 60e5bbf762f04845d5320fe427a81051ee44bee90eec5c2edca8b1bc55fbaad2:3

value
37538
script pubkey
OP_0 OP_PUSHBYTES_20 1d3f3559f68d11791aa0ce7f98b2b84058bdc9e2
address
bc1qr5ln2k0k35ghjx4qeele3v4cgpvtmj0zcej4fa
transaction
60e5bbf762f04845d5320fe427a81051ee44bee90eec5c2edca8b1bc55fbaad2
confirmations
677
spent
true